What to confirm before enrolling

  • current availability, registration deadlines, and waitlists
  • eligibility, age range, support level, and whether the setting is a fit
  • staff preparation, safety policies, cost, schedule, and location details

Autism Society Northwest Ohio

Autism Society Northwest Ohio

Toledo, Ohio - Lucas County

Autism Society Northwest Ohio provides autism support groups, information and referral, education, advocacy, Sibshops, an adult social group, and resource library support across 12 Northwest Ohio counties.

Bittersweet Farms Social and Recreational Programs

Bittersweet Farms

Whitehouse, Ohio - Lucas County

Bittersweet Farms in Whitehouse offers year-round social and recreational programming for autistic teens and adults, plus a six-week summer enrichment program for adolescents with autism.

Imagination Station Sensory Friendly Hours

Imagination Station

Toledo, Ohio - Lucas County

Imagination Station in Toledo holds sensory friendly hours on the third Sunday of every month and provides visitor support information for families planning a science museum visit.

National Museum of the Great Lakes Sensory Friendly Weekends

National Museum of the Great Lakes

Toledo, Ohio - Lucas County

National Museum of the Great Lakes Sensory Friendly Weekends adds current Toledo sensory venue depth with recurring second-weekend museum hours, limited crowds, dimmed lighting, lowered exhibit sounds, an accessibility cart, and Museums for All information.

Toledo Museum of Art Sensory Accessibility

Toledo Museum of Art

Toledo, Ohio - Lucas County

Toledo Museum of Art offers sensory kits, noise-canceling headphones, Certified Autism Center resources, and scheduled Touch Tours for blind and low-vision guests.
